Welcome to the web site for the United States Attorney's Office for the Western District of Washington. As the chief federal law enforcement officer in Western Washington, it is the job of the U.S. Attorney and her staff to enforce the criminal laws of the United States by directing investigations and prosecuting cases developed by a network of federal law enforcement agencies. The office also fills a critical role as legal counsel for the United States government including federal agencies involved in litigation. The threats to our communities are many: terrorism, gun violence, organized crime, financial fraud and the scourge of drug dealing. In an increasingly complex world, many of these crimes cross borders and span cyberspace – they target both our physical and financial security. The 68 attorneys and 69 support staff in this office work every day to enhance the safety and security of Western Washington and make it an even better place to live.
